See Furthermore.While every monster has the data that a player would need to enjoy the beast as a personality, most enemies are not really suitable as PCs. Creatures who have got an Cleverness rating of 2 or lower, who have no method to communicate, or who are usually so different from various other PCs that they interrupt the advertising campaign should not really be utilized. Some creatures have unusual innate skills or excellent physical strength, and hence are sketchy at best as heroes (except in high-level campaigns).Starting Level of a Creature PCMonsters suitable for play possess a degree adjustment provided in their statistics.
Add a creature's degree adjustment to its Humanoids and Course Amounts to obtain the beast's effective character level, or ECL. Successfully, monsters with a level adjustment turn out to be multiclass character when they consider class ranges. A beast's “monster class” can be generally a popular course, and the animal never requires XP penalties for having it.Humanoids and Class LevelsCreatures with 1 or much less HD replace their creature ranges with their character levels. The creature manages to lose the strike bonus, bonuses, abilities, and achievements granted by its 1 beast HD and gains the assault bonus, save bonus deals, skills, feats, and some other class skills of a 1st-level character of the appropriate class.Personas with more than 1 Strike Die because of their competition do not get a task for their 1st class level as people of the common races perform, and they do not grow the ability points for their first class level by four.

Instead, they have already received a feat for their initial Hit Die because of competition, and they have got already increased their racial skill points for their initial Hit Die by four.Level Modification and Efficient Personality LevelTo determine the effective character degree (ECL) of a beast character, add its level modification to its racial Hit Chop and personality class levels.Use ECL instead of character level to determine how numerous experience factors a monster character needs to achieve its next level. Furthermore make use of ECL to determine starting wealth for a monster character.Creature characters deal with skills talked about in their monster entry as class abilities.If a creature provides 1 Hit Die or much less, or if it is definitely a monster, it must begin the game with one or even more class levels, like a normal personality. If a creature has 2 or more Hit Dice, it can start with no course levels (though it can gain them later).Also if the beast is certainly of a type that normally developments by Hit Dice rather than class levels a Computer can obtain class amounts instead than Hit Dice.Strike DiceThe creature's Strike Dice identical the quantity of class ranges it has plus its racial Hit Dice. Extra Hit Dice acquired from consuming ranges in a personality class by no means impact a beast's size like extra racial Strike Dice do.Feat Pay for and Capability Rating IncreasesA monster's complete Hit Dice, not really its ECL, govern its exchange of feats and ability score increases.Ability Ratings for Monster PCsWhile a monsters statistics provide the ability scores for a regular creature of a particular kind, any “beast” monster that gets to be an adventurer will be definitely not really typical. As a result, when developing a PC from a beast, examine to find if the beast's admittance offers any ability scores of 10 or higher. If so, for each score, subtract 10 (if the rating is actually) or 11 (if the rating is unusual) to obtain the monster's modifier for that capability structured on its competition or type.

From Crusader Kings II Wiki. The Roman Empire is a titular Empire title. With Legacy of Rome expansion, it is possible, as Emperor of the Byzantine Empire, to restore the Roman Empire by controlling key duchies of the old empire. The Byzantine Empire must also be your primary title. Restoring Rome has the following effects. The Roman Empire is a potential de jure empire consisting of 9 kingdom titles, 40 duchy titles and 122 county titles. The title does not exist by default in the timeframe of Crusader Kings II or The Old Gods DLC, but can be created by the player or the AI. Creating the Roman Empire requires Legacy of Rome DLC.
